The U.S. Department of Agriculture (“USDA”) recently published a proposed rule that would require all federal contractors to certify compliance with 16 applicable labor laws. The certification requires an affirmative statement attesting compliance and further requires contractors to “promptly report[] to the contracting officer if and when adjudicated evidence of noncompliance occurs.” Under ...

ORLANDO, Fla. — “Miya’s Law,” which aims to improve tenant safety in apartments has passed through both chambers of the Florida legislature.
The Bill now sits on Governor Ron DeSantis’ desk, waiting to be signed in to law.
Sponsored by Orlando Senator Linda Stewart, the bill would require apartment landlords to perform background checks on new employees.
